深入解析比特币钱包的加密算法及其安全性

比特币钱包是什么?

说到比特币钱包,可能有些朋友觉得它比较复杂,听起来像什么高深的科技。但其实,简单来说,比特币钱包就是你用来存储、接收和发送比特币的一种工具。可以类比一下,像你生活中用的银行账户,只不过这里面存的可是一种虚拟货币。

比特币钱包分为热钱包和冷钱包。热钱包是在线钱包,你随时可以访问,用起来超方便;冷钱包则是离线储存,像是把比特币放在了一个保险箱里,更加安全。自己要搞清楚,哪种方式更适合自己。

为什么需要加密算法?

好,咱们回到加密算法的问题。既然钱包里存的是比特币,那就得有个办法保护这些比特币,防止别人随便进来拿走。这时候,加密算法就显得尤为重要。这些算法像是给比特币钱包装上了一个“保险锁”。

比特币钱包普遍使用的是公钥和私钥的加密体系。公钥就是你的地址,别人可以通过这个地址向你转账。而私钥则是你唯一的“钥匙”,用来证明你是这笔比特币的所有者。想象一下,如果你有一个房子,公钥就像是你家门的门牌号,大家都能看到;而私钥就像是打开你家门的钥匙,只有你自己才有,没人能帮你拥有。

常见的加密算法

现在市面上有很多种加密算法,但最广泛应用于比特币的钱包通常是椭圆曲线加密(ECDSA)。有点复杂,但其实就是一个数学模型,用于生成公钥和私钥。

椭圆曲线加密的好处是,即使你的私钥很短,生成的公钥依然很长而且安全,能够抵御各种攻击。这就像是你用一个小小的密码锁,能锁住一个大仓库,使用起来又方便。大多数钱包都是用这种算法,所以安全性很好。

加密算法背后的安全性

加密算法的安全性越来越受到关注,特别是随着区块链技术的不断发展,攻击者的攻击方式也是层出不穷。说个老实话,如果你的私钥泄露了,就相当于你家门没锁,任何人都能进来。很多人可能会问,怎么才能保护自己的私钥呢?

最好的办法,就是尽量不把私钥放在联网的设备上。冷钱包是个好选择。此外,有些钱包还提供了双重认证功能,假如有人真想弄点小动作,通过二次验证才能完成交易。

如何选择安全的钱包?

选择比特币钱包,安全性是重点。要确保钱包提供商使用强大的加密算法,比如椭圆曲线加密,同时支持两步验证。不仅如此,还要查看钱包的口碑,看看有没有人反映被盗或安全漏洞的问题。自己做些功课也是必要的。

有些钱包是开源的,这意味着任何人都可以检查它们的代码,看看有没有漏洞。这样的钱包往往更让人放心。一些常见的钱包如Trezor、Ledger和Exodus等,都是广受好评的选择。

个人经验分享

作为一个在数字货币世界潜水了一段时间的人,我自己最担心的就是私钥的问题。记得有一次,我的一个朋友因为把私钥放在了云端,结果被盗了不少比特币!我看着他懊悔的模样,真的是心痛不已。所以,在我自己的比特币钱包使用上,我始终保持着小心谨慎的态度。

我目前使用的是冷钱包,听说这能大大减少被盗的风险。同时,我把私钥写在纸上,还分几份存放在不同的地方,绝对不让它暴露在网络上。大家真得考虑一下自己的安全策略。

未来的发展趋势

说实话,比特币钱包和其加密算法的发展永远不会停下脚步。随着量子计算的发展,我们可能会迎来新的挑战。量子计算的运算速度可不是一般的快,传统加密算法可能在它面前显得脆弱。

不过,技术也在不断进步。一些科学家和程序员开始研究量子抗性算法,旨在提升数字货币的安全性。所以,未来可能会有新的加密算法出现,来保护我们的比特币财产。

总结一下

虽然比特币钱包和加密算法听起来有点距离,但其实它们跟我们的生活息息相关。搞清楚钱包的加密逻辑后,我们可以更好地保护自己的资产。选择合适的钱包,了解加密算法的原理,保持警惕,才能在这个数字货币的海洋中游得更稳。

希望这篇分享能对你们有所帮助,真心让大家在投资比特币的路上多一份安全感,少几分担忧!如果有任何问题,随时来交流哦!